WebCatalog is a cross-platform application designed to transfer different webapps to the desktop. The idea is not something new or has not been done before, there is Mozilla Prism
to testify that it has been trying to do something like that since
2009. Now, the software we are dealing with has an updated design and an
interesting catalog of applications.
As for the applications it integrates, we can find password managers like 1Password or LastPass, we can read books through Kiddle Cloud Reader or Google Play Books, install productivity applications such as Asana or Todoist, write a blog post thanks to Medium, consult Reddit, talk with our friends with Facebook Messenger and even check the news with Feedly or Inoreader.
